Microcontroller Programming for Power Electronics Engineers is a specialized course designed to equip electronics engineers with the skills needed to effectively program microcontrollers. This course focuses on the integration of microcontrollers in electronic systems and enables engineers to develop and optimize control algorithms for various electronic applications. You will learn how to use microcontroller programming to improve the operation and performance of converters, motor drives, and other electronic devices.<\/p>\n<p dir=\"ltr\">This course covers the basics of microcontroller programming suitable for electronic applications. You will learn how to select and configure microcontrollers for electronic systems, develop control algorithms, and interface microcontrollers with devices. This course includes hands-on projects to practice real-world applications, such as designing and implementing feedback control systems for converters and motor drives.
